[REL] SH3 Validator
SH Validator v2.0.3 (something I made for SH5 that I ported over to SH4)
This app will verify your SH3/4/5 installation for common errors/bugs. It's best used after you have installed mods to see if anything was 'broke'. Is it perfect? No. There is much more to code in for checking but as is it's very useful It's very easy to use. Once you run the app it will immediately start validating your SH3/4/5 installation. Any errors reported can be found in associated boxes (plus the box will tell you how many errors are contained in it). The app now lets you select the path to the install folder or have it read from registry The app now also displays the .exe file version in the title bar The app now lets you choose to validate SH3, SH4, or SH5 starting with v1.7.0 you can now save the errors to a text file (after validation is complete you'll have option to save errors). You also have the ability to add missing files from the classes to an ignore list (I've predefined some files for the ignore list that are not required for the game) starting with v1.9.0 the log file generated now shows the countries defined, all the classes and types defined, and a breakdown of the roster (Country and units defined). This will greatly benefit modders and those curious to see what each country has. I've also made the textboxes more user friendly by enabling horizontal scrolling and indenting entries. A menu bar has been added that will allow you to save the log file (again) and re-validate (choosing which SH version) without having to close the app down and restart. If you find the app useful then If you don't then also! The above was ran on Stock 1.4b version of game NOTE: Errors in the classes have to be interpreted. Some files are not required for some units.
